features a menu-driven interface to adjust PID settings, set points, and alarm values. Setting the Temperature (SV) Press the SET key once. Use the arrow keys ( ) to adjust the Set Value (SV) to your desired temperature. Press SET again to save and return to the main screen. | | Possible Cause | Recommended Solution | | :--- | :--- | :--- | | HHHH | Input signal is above the sensor's maximum range. | Check that the temperature is within the sensor's range. Verify the INPH parameter is not set too low. | | LLLL | Input signal is below the sensor's minimum range or the thermocouple is reversed. | Check for reversed thermocouple connections. Verify the INPL parameter is not set too high. | | OrAL | Open circuit (Sensor Break Protection). | Check the sensor for breaks or damage. Ensure the sensor is securely connected to the correct terminals. | | Errl | Internal system error or unstable power supply. | Power cycle the controller. If it persists, the controller may be faulty. | | Output ON but no heat | Relay/SSR failure or wiring issue. | Check the output device for proper activation. Verify all wiring from the controller's output terminals to the final load. | | Wild temperature fluctuations | Incorrect PID settings or a poor sensor connection. | Run the Auto-Tune (AT) function. Check all sensor wiring for loose contacts. | | Controller won't save settings | Parameter lock is active ( LOCK > 0). | Enter the parameter menu, find LOCK , and set it to 0 or the known unlock code. |

The is a popular, cost-effective, intelligent digital temperature controller used in industrial and laboratory heating applications, packaging machines, and plastic molding . Its ability to provide precise PID (Proportional-Integral-Derivative) control makes it a favorite for engineers and DIY enthusiasts needing stable, accurate heat management.
